How does culture cause conflict?

A cultural conflict is a dislike, hostility, or struggle between communities who have different philosophies and ways of living, resulting in contradictory aspirations and behaviors. ... Furthermore, stereotypes, prejudice, and culture shock are important factors which may lead to conflict (Hottola 2004).
